Plesk: How do I Start, Stop and Restart Plesk from the Command Line?

Symptom: You need to Start, Stop, or Restart Plesk from the Command line

Solution:

Start: sudo /etc/init.d/psa start

Stop: sudo /etc/init.d/psa stop

Restart: sudo /etc/init.d/psa restart
